Safety in Belgium


Belgium Police on motorcyclesBelgium has a relatively low crime rate. Petty crimes, like pickpocketing and mugging, do occur in the cities, but more serious crimes are rare.

Expats will generally feel very safe within their apartments or homes. The EU and NATO headquarters are located in Brussels and residents should be aware of the risk of these organisations becoming targets for indiscriminate terrorist attacks.
